It might be an IHC, but except for the very early ones (Kemp, Corn King, Cloverleaf, etc.), they had steel sides. This one may have had the sides replaced. It's hard to pin it down with just one picture; a picture of the back end would be helpful as the auger/slinger was distinctly different between brands. As far as parts, unless the part you need was generic enough to be used for a long time, finding another similar spreader may be the only way to find needed parts. I have some brochures and parts manuals for different brands, but would need some more pictures or parts #'s to narrow it down.

The only thing I can see that may be definitive for an IH spreader is the zig zag cleats on the rear wheels. I'm not seeing that on any of the other spreaders that I have info on. Some of the other features don't seem to match though. If you can read any part #'s (hub, etc) that would help too.
